Abstract: | The properties of the hyperdeterminant, a genuine multipartite entanglement figure of merit for 4 qubits, are studied. We analyze when the hyperdeterminant detects quantum phase transitions and how it is related to the wave function of the system. By studying the ground state of two well-known quantum hamiltonians, Ising and XXZ, we analyze how entanglement behaves in terms of the hyperdeterminant. To conclude, we introduce finite temperature effects which leads us to explore the full spectrum of energies of both models. |
